Responsibilities
Deliverable 1: Workload Analysis Report
- Conduct Activity Mapping: Deconstruct departmental functions into specific tasks to quantify the volume, frequency, and average duration of recurring operations.
- Analyze Time Allocation: Evaluate the distribution of hours.
- Identify Process Bottlenecks: Pinpoint systemic delays or points of friction where manual intervention or redundant approvals artificially inflate the required workload.
- Benchmark Operational Efficiency: Compare current output levels against industry standard times and internal KPIs to determine a baseline for standardized performance.
Deliverable 2: Staffing Requirement Report
- Calculate FTE Requirements: Translate the validated workload data into precise Full-Time Equivalent (FTE) numbers required to sustain daily operations without burnout.
